Chucks Margarita Grill



This is one of my favorite mexican restaurants! Actually, I suppose is the only mexican restaurant I care about. It is a combination mexican and steak house restaurant, according to the website, it explains the building was originally a working dairy farm and if you saw it, you would see why! it was clearly once a barn of some kind, which makes it charming and rustic. It was first called Chucks Steak House, but eventually a mexican menu and the name soon transformed. (website here!)

I have heard people say this mexican food is not all that authentic and that it is americanized, but I love it! They start you out with corn chips that are warm and seem fresh out of the fryer, though I am not sure if they are home made or just warmed under a heat light, but they are always delicious and above standard of a regular store bought corn chip, and their salsa is excellent! A great starter snack while you wait and look over the menu!





Ive tried a number of things on the menu, but my all time favorite thing probably what might be considered a mexican stand by, a ground beef burrito, otherwise named on the menu as Chucks Burrito Grande - Choice of seasoned ground beef, chicken or tender chunks of sirloin with refritos in a four tortilla, topped with cheese, house made red chili sauce and served with sour cream. I always go for the ground beef. Its one of those situations where I dont go often enough, so by the time I go back I want the same thing, because I have been craving it!




I also tried with my husband an appetizer of Potato Skins - Six potato skins loaded with cheese and bacon. Served with sour cream for dipping. This was quite good! They are a bit filling and a bit heavy being that it is potato and cheese! But they did reheat well back home, and nothing like saving a small to-go bag for later in the evening when one gets hungry again!

The service here is always great, I have never had anything bad to say about the waiters or waitresses. I will say that sometimes the wait can get up to over forty minutes sometimes. The later you go the more likely you will be up in a queue and given one of those devices that flag a party down by flashing when a table is ready for you. If you dont like waiting I recommend going early when it just opens around four or five pm. And below, a silly picture of me!
